    KPF completes South Korea's tallest skyscraper

    American firm Kohn Pedersen Fox has completed the 555-metre-high Lotte World Tower in Seoul, which is now the tallest building in South Korea and the fifth-tallest building in the world. More about KPF completes South Korea's tallest skyscraper

  • Workplace design must change to combat "epidemic" stress levels says UNStudio founder

    Secluded pods that allow office workers to meditate, smash things or scream will be commonplace in two years time says UNStudio founder Ben van Berkel, after research found that stress-related illness costs the US economy $300 billion a year.
